Experts maintenance WordPress depuis 2016 | 4.7/5 avis vérifiés

Comment optimiser l’API REST WordPress avec le format JSON

Serveurs d'hébergement web sécurisés pour WordPress avec support JSON, expertise française Hostay.
Sommaire

Pourquoi le JSON est-il important pour WordPress ?

Le JSON s’est imposé comme une pièce maîtresse dans l’écosystème WordPress. Sa syntaxe claire et son format allégé en font un excellent vecteur d’échange entre différents systèmes. Pour un site WordPress moderne, il facilite grandement les communications entre composants, que ce soit pour enrichir l’interface utilisateur ou connecter le site à des services externes. Les développeurs l’adoptent naturellement pour créer des fonctionnalités avancées et des expériences web plus riches.

Interaction dynamique avec l’API REST de WordPress

Le dialogue entre WordPress et les applications se fait principalement via son API REST, qui utilise le JSON comme langage commun. Cette approche permet d’enrichir un site avec des fonctionnalités interactives comme l’affichage instantané de nouveaux contenus ou la mise à jour d’éléments spécifiques. Les visiteurs profitent ainsi d’une navigation plus fluide, sans les traditionnels rechargements de page qui ralentissent l’expérience.

Le JSON et WordPress : Guide pratique

L’intégration du JSON avec WordPress permet de créer des expériences web dynamiques et interactives. Découvrons ensemble les bases pour bien débuter.

Premiers pas avec l’API

WordPress intègre depuis quelques années une interface API moderne. Cette fonctionnalité, accessible dès l’installation, permet d’échanger des données structurées. Bien sûr, il est conseillé d’appliquer les bonnes pratiques de sécurité pour protéger vos échanges.

Mise en pratique

  • Explorez les différentes routes disponibles pour accéder aux contenus de votre site (billets, médias, commentaires…)
  • Testez vos requêtes avec des outils comme Insomnia ou écrivez du code avec fetch en JS
  • Apprenez à traiter et afficher les données reçues selon les besoins de votre projet

Comment le JSON booste vos performances et votre visibilité

Le format JSON apporte des bénéfices concrets pour la rapidité d’affichage et la visibilité de votre site WordPress dans les moteurs de recherche.

Un site plus rapide et réactif

En chargeant les données de façon dynamique, le JSON permet d’alléger considérablement le poids des pages. Au lieu de tout charger d’un coup, votre site récupère uniquement les informations utiles quand l’utilisateur en a besoin. Cette approche rend la navigation plus fluide et agréable. Les visiteurs apprécient un site rapide, et les moteurs de recherche aussi!

Une meilleure compréhension par les robots

Grâce au balisage JSON-LD, les moteurs de recherche identifient plus facilement le contenu de vos pages. Cette structuration des données peut faire apparaître des informations enrichies dans les résultats de recherche, attirant davantage l’attention des internautes. Pour aller plus loin sur ce sujet, découvrez notre article complet sur les techniques SEO WordPress en 2024.

Les aspects sécuritaires à considérer avec le JSON

L’usage du JSON apporte de nombreux bénéfices, mais nécessite une attention particulière aux questions de sécurité qu’il soulève.

Prévention des vulnérabilités web courantes

Les interactions dynamiques peuvent rendre votre site vulnérable aux injections malveillantes et aux requêtes non autorisées. Voici quelques bonnes pratiques essentielles :

  • Vérifiez minutieusement l’intégrité des données entrantes avant traitement.
  • Exploitez les mécanismes de protection intégrés à WordPress.
  • Établissez des règles d’authentification rigoureuses pour vos points d’accès API.

Pour plus d’informations, consultez notre guide sur la sécurisation des formulaires WordPress avec CAPTCHA.

Limitation des accès à l’API pour les visiteurs anonymes

Dans certains cas, il peut être judicieux de limiter l’accès aux données JSON aux seuls utilisateurs authentifiés. Des outils comme Disable JSON API permettent de gérer ces restrictions. Cette approche renforce la protection de vos informations confidentielles.

Comment tirer le meilleur parti du JSON sous WordPress ?

Une maintenance proactive est la clé

Gardez votre installation WordPress fraîche et performante en appliquant régulièrement les correctifs disponibles. Un système à niveau offre une meilleure résistance face aux menaces externes. Pour approfondir ce sujet crucial, consultez notre article sur les avantages d’une maintenance planifiée.

La sauvegarde, votre filet de sécurité

Anticipez les imprévus en créant systématiquement des copies de secours avant d’implémenter des changements majeurs, notamment lors de l’ajout de fonctionnalités JSON. Un système de backup fiable vous protège contre les mauvaises surprises. Découvrez notre offre d’accompagnement technique pour sécuriser votre site.

L’importance des tests préalables

Privilégiez un environnement de test pour valider vos développements JSON. Cette approche permet d’identifier les dysfonctionnements potentiels sans risque pour votre site principal. Si vous butez sur des obstacles, explorez nos ressources sur le diagnostic WordPress ou contactez nos experts.

Intégration avancée : WordPress et les applications mobiles

Les technologies REST et JSON permettent désormais de connecter votre site WordPress à des applications mobiles sur mesure, créant ainsi un écosystème digital complet.

Applications multiplateformes modernes

Les plateformes comme React Native et Ionic facilitent la création d’apps mobiles basées sur le web. Votre site WordPress dialogue naturellement avec ces outils grâce aux échanges de données via JSON.

Actualisation fluide du contenu

L’échange des données en JSON assure une mise à jour harmonieuse entre votre site et ses apps. Les modifications se propagent naturellement sur l’ensemble des plateformes, garantissant une cohérence parfaite.

Optimiser WordPress avec des extensions JSON

Voici quelques extensions essentielles qui faciliteront l’intégration et l’utilisation du JSON dans votre site WordPress.

Extension ACF-REST

Cette extension pratique permet d’exposer facilement les champs personnalisés créés avec Advanced Custom Fields dans l’API REST. Elle simplifie grandement le développement d’applications utilisant ces données.

Cache API REST

Cette extension optimise les temps de réponse en mettant automatiquement en cache les requêtes JSON de l’API REST. Les performances de votre site s’en trouvent nettement améliorées.

Hostay accompagne votre site WordPress dans l’utilisation optimale du JSON

En tant qu’experts français du web, nous mettons notre savoir-faire au service de votre site WordPress. Notre équipe vous accompagne pour une exploitation optimale et sécurisée du JSON, avec des solutions adaptées à vos besoins spécifiques.

Des audits sécurité complets

Nos analyses de sécurité approfondies examinent notamment la configuration de votre API REST et l’intégration du JSON pour détecter d’éventuelles vulnérabilités.

Un suivi technique permanent

Grâce à nos solutions de maintenance dédiées, votre site bénéficie d’une surveillance continue et des dernières mises à jour, garantissant performances et sécurité optimales.

Un support client disponible

Notre équipe technique reste à l’écoute pour répondre à vos questions et optimiser l’intégration du JSON dans votre site. Découvrez l’étendue de nos prestations d’assistance WordPress pensées pour votre réussite.

Conclusion

L’intégration du format JSON transforme les sites WordPress en véritables plateformes web modernes. Cette technologie, bien que simple en apparence, nécessite une approche méthodique et des connaissances approfondies pour optimiser son potentiel. Notre équipe chez Hostay met son expertise à votre disposition pour développer des solutions personnalisées, performantes et robustes. Vous souhaitez améliorer votre présence en ligne ? Échangeons sur vos besoins spécifiques et construisons ensemble un projet qui répond à vos attentes. La réussite de votre site web reste notre priorité absolue.

Hostay : L’assistance technique WordPress ultra-réactive

Je suis Nicolas LECAT, responsable du support et manager de l'équipe technique Hostay.
Appelez-moi de 09:00 à 18:00 au 07 49 55 53 01
Demandez de l'aide à un de nos experts WordPress !
Gratuit, non engageant
10 min

    Vos informations seront uniquement utilisées pour vous contacter dans le cadre de la résolution de votre problème.

    Partager cet article